by Journal Academica Foundation (NY).JAcad. Deep Dive brings you inside the world of cutting-edge open-access research. Produced by the Journal Academica Foundation, this series explores key ideas and technologies transforming science. JAcad. is an IPFS-based publishing for decentralized, immutable knowledge sharing. Each episode highlights work from diverse fields— philosophy, mathematics, physics, computer science, biology, and more—with a focus on global accessibility, peer-to-peer science, and the mission to make verified knowledge truly public.
